Project Info

Web Security Measurement and Analysis

Chuan Yue
chuanyue@mines.edu

Project Goals and Description:

A variety of web-based attacks such as phishing, cross-site scripting, and drive-by download have been continuously causing severe damages to users and organizations for over two decades. It is very challenging to effectively defend against them especially because they continuously evolve and adapt to the countermeasures. In this project, we design systems, algorithms, and user studies to measure and analyze new security risks on the web.

More Information:

Grand Challenge: Secure cyberspace.

[1] Mengxia Ren, Anhao Xiang, and Chuan Yue, "Analyzing the Feasibility of Adopting Google’s Nonce-Based CSP Solutions on Websites", in Proceedings of the IEEE/ACM International Conference on Software Engineering (ICSE), 2025.

[2] Mengxia Ren and Chuan Yue, "Content Security Policy Deployment Issues Related to Third-party Scripts among Builder-generated Websites and Other Websites", in Proceedings of the IEEE International Performance Computing and Communications Conference (IPCCC), 2024.

[3] Mengxia Ren and Chuan Yue, "Coverage and Secure Use Analysis of Content Security Policies via Clustering", in Proceedings of the IEEE European Symposium on Security and Privacy (EuroS&P), 2023.

[4] Weiping Pei, Arthur Mayer, Kaylynn Tu, and Chuan Yue, “Attention Please: Your Attention Check Questions in Survey Studies Can Be Automatically Answered”, in Proceedings of the Web Conference (formerly known as the WWW Conference), 2020. Please contact Dr. Chuan Yue (chuanyue@mines.edu) for more publications and resources.

Primary Contacts:

Dr. Chuan Yue (chuanyue@mines.edu) and his PhD students (TBD).

Student Preparation

Qualifications

Students who major in Computer Science, already took 200-level CS courses, familiar with Web programming techniques.

TIME COMMITMENT (HRS/WK)

4~5 hours per week.

SKILLS/TECHNIQUES GAINED

Research methodology; system design principles and skills; research paper reading, presentation, and writing; communication.

MENTORING PLAN

1. Weekly project meeting. 2. Highly level guidance on research direction and methodology. 3. Teamwork with PhD and master students.

Preferred Student Status

Sophomore
Junior
Senior
Share This